    Note: this is not reviewing their shipping services…read more I had driven past Sip and Ship sites for years, Ballard now shuttered, and Greenwood remained open. However, their 2/25/26 IG post caught my attention with regards of their version of Cafe Besalu's ginger biscuit. Direct quote: "reimagined by our talented baker Emma in our little bakery corner. She's perfected the texture, warmth, and that signature ginger sparkle." Some background info: Cafe Besalu was a beloved pastry shop in Ballard from 2000 - 2017. When the original owner and his family moved to Spain, the shop was sold to Herkimer Coffee, which then later closed the site permanently in 2023. Their 3/2/26 IG post literally got me in my car..."Flaky. Buttery. Perfectly spiced with that subtle ginger warmth that makes you pause mid-bite. This isn't just a cookie. It's a little Ballard classic - now freshly baked, ready, and waiting for you." I was able to get a parking spot close to the shop, never been until that morning. I was literally floored that this indeed had shipping and retail areas, but also an actual cafe with onsite seating - cafe tables and a window facing counter. But oh my what stopped me in my tracks was seeing the pastry case. I haven't seen such a lovely display in awhile. It seems most places, product are stacked, messy display case trays full of crumbs and pastries askew. Clearly head baker, Emma, takes full pride with the variety of baked goods nicely curated. I was told that the ginger biscuits were just pulled from the oven an hour ago. I purchased two of them and also one each of the peanut butter cookie and ginger molasses cookie. Heavenly scents permeated my car as I drove back north. The ginger biscuit had a nice tender, moist crumb. The Homie savored this the same day and brought him back to his childhood. I ate mine the next day and it was superb. Perfect distribution of the candied ginger warmth and that notable bejeweled top texture. Delicious! The ginger molasses cookie had that perfect balance of crisp edges and moist chew. The sugar exterior literally sparkled when I photographed it while on a road trip stop. The peanut butter cookie was ginormous and was very delicate. It had broken into five pieces. It was relatively thin, had a sandy texture, and subtle peanut butter flavor. The Phinney Ridge - Greenwood - Ballard neighborhoods has quite a collection of indie cafes and bakeshops. I'll have to say that Sip & Ship in Greenwood provided that gotcha moment with their high quality, fresh baked goods. Note to self - they have shipping and notary services too. But those baked goods....definitely, I'll be back!
